Antoine Griezmann: “It was a difficult first year at Barcelona.”

Atlético Madrid forward Antoine Griezmann will be one of the main talking points going into Sunday’s game between Barcelona and Atlético at Camp Nou.

Griezmann had a tough spell at Barcelona, where he struggled with a number of things. His departure saw Atlético fans go against him, and he found it difficult to play alongside Lionel Messi.

“It was a difficult first year, as a substitute, not playing, another system, another position… I had to get used to all that,” Griezmann told DAZN in words transcribed by Mundo Deportivo.

He went on to play 48 games for the Catalan club, scoring 15 goals and providing four assists. He was a starter in 41 games.

Better second season for Griezmann at Barcelona

The Frenchman said that in his second season, everything was better for him. “I liked my second year, I enjoyed it,” he continued.

The Atlético Madrid player also spoke about Atlético’s fine run of form of late. The club have gone 12 games unbeaten, with many now wondering if Simeone’s side could have fought for the La Liga title had they not had such a poor start to the season.

“We can ask ourselves that question, because we are playing at a high level, winning every game. You start to think about it and it could be the case. But that’s football.

“Now we’re on another run and we have to enjoy what we have. We’ve got a big game ahead of us. We’ll try to go there and win and get the three points,” Griezmann added.
